I am trying to create a query that lists records from table 1 along with a status based on corresponding records in table 2 that have null values in one or more of the fields. The problem I am running into is how to include records from table 1 which have no corresponding record in table 2.
In my example, I want to list the names of all students in tblStudent along with a field indicating the status of their schedule in tblStudentSchedule. If either course or teacher field in tblStudentSchedule is Null or no corresponding record in tblStudentSchedule is found then I want to display "Incomplete". Otherwise, I want to display "Complete".
desired result
Name | Schedule Status
-----------------------
Bob | Incomplete
Sally | Incomplete
Jane | Incomplete
Matt | Incomplete
Jim | Complete
I'm working in Access. I would post my query attempts but I think they would just confuse the issue. This is probably very basic but I am having a mental block trying to wrap my brain around this one.
tblStudent
studentID | studentName
-----------------------
1 | Bob
2 | Sally
3 | Jane
4 | Matt
5 | Jim
tblStudentSchedule
studentID | period | course | teacher
-------------------------------------
1 | 1 | math | Jones
1 | 2 | <null> | Watson
2 | 1 | reading| <null>
4 | 1 | <null> | Crick
5 | 1 | math | Jones
